These rare, antiquarian, First Edition, 2-volume, Jerusalem history books, are entitled "Jerusalem: The Topography, Economics and History from the Earliest Times to A.D. 70". These books were written by George Adam Smith, and are a complete 2-volume set. Published in 1908 by Hodder and Stoughton in London, these 2 hardback, First Edition books are in very good condition overall, with the pages, maps, illustrations, and the burgundy clothbound hardcovers of each book being in very good condition.
